Slamming the Bharatiya Janata Party for criticizing the central government for bluntly rejecting the Standard & Poor's (S&P) report on India's possible downgrade, Congress spokesperson Manish Tiwari has hit back at the former saying that the ratings were only an opinion of the agency. Meanwhile, BJP leader Yeshwant Sinha stated that there was a lack of trust in the government in the event of the economic slowdown in the country. Union corporate affairs minister Veerappa Moily, on the other hand, discarded the report saying that a rating agency was not apt enough to rate a huge economy like India.
